前端跨域问题?

目标服务器只支持同源请求,如果只用纯前端实现跨域是不是就实现不了(不考虑通过后端),用fetch来跨域,服务器不是自己的无法修改,应该不成功,用ajax jsonp跨域,返回数据时json,xml,html无法解析报SyntaxError,所以在此场景下只通过前台实现跨域是不是无法实现。

阅读 1.9k
2 个回答

如果纯前端能够解决这个问题,服务器的同源限制不就形同虚设了吗?

跨域是因为浏览器需要同源策略请求 如果不修改后端 前端可以用反向代理请求

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题